Transaction 598b3175b17c01e7f02fd5ea769d8f686697e7324d002cd7d8b2f9d07b42c088
1 Input
1 Output
-
598b3175b17c01e7f02fd5ea769d8f686697e7324d002cd7d8b2f9d07b42c088:0
- value
- 435069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 522761d4ba7fd43f07f548f172a57b250fdcf494 OP_EQUAL
- address
- 39BQWbPeauE71A31rfE7SwEMRuXuRzqtzW